It's In The Jar!

Over Christmas, I saw something on Facebook which made me think.  I saw a screw-top jar filled to the brim with notes and the caption: 'Next year, get a glass jar and each time something good happens to you - no matter how small - write it on a bit of note paper and put it inside the jar.  At the end of the year, open the jar and pour out the notes and you will see all the great things that have happened to you!'
Well, while I was at Brunswick Heads, I did just that.  I bought a screw-top glass jar at FDB's at Ocean Shores and this year, I began filling it with notes of good things.  So far, I have two notes in it and it's sitting on my kitchen counter waiting for the year to pass so I can fill it to the brim with more!
